Skip to main content
MENU

Main menu

  • Home
  • Clients
  • About
  • Ideas
  • Institute
  • Careers
  • Contact

Ideas

Innovation leads to progress

Our ideas lead to innovations for our clients and the community.

Back to Ideas
June 27, 2012

Who moved my calendar? Finding your way around Drupal's new calendar module update

Written by
Blink Reaction

Building calendars and upcoming events in Drupal has evolved significantly since the days of 4.6 and 4.7 and the storied Events module. You may be surprised - even caught off guard - to know it has changed significantly for the better only very recently.

The new 7.x-3.4 version of the module just released on May 19 now makes use of views templates. In previous versions after enabling the Calendar module a visit to your Views listing page would show several views installed by the Calendar module. It was immensely satisfying at first to see the new view with its various displays for day, week, month, etc. Until you discovered that your events would were not showing up on their actual dates but on the date in which they were created. Site builders would then go through the painstaking process of custom configuring a contextual filter (argument) for your event date rather than the default 'created date' used by the module upon install.

Thanks to module developer KarenS this problem is a thing of the past. Once you get over the shock and dismay of not finding the familiar default calendar view in your listing you will notice the new 'add from template' link at the top of the page. Click it, select your date preference and you are in the home stretch.

This is one of the best usability improvements for one of the most common tasks in Drupal. And despite several good online resources guiding site builders through the custom contextual filter configuration, the old way was still confusing and time consuming.

For hands on face to face training by expert Drupalists on everything from Site Building to Module Development visit www.blinkreaction.com/training

What you are used to seeing.

What you see now

Find your date field

Name it

done

your view

No changing contextual filters

Usability
Drupal
Drupal Planet

More Ideas

A New Milestone for Blink Reaction
Launching Drupal Face to Face
Ramping Up for Action at Blink
e-Learning Experience with Drupal
Drupal for the .NET programmer
Caching Drupal for the NYC MTA
A Very Special Drupal Birthday
Free Drupal
Local Drupal Install Best Practices
Go Mobile: Grab a Seat, Get Back to Basics
Drupal Summer Camp Recap
Training Notes: Helping Students Understand...
Now Playing: Drupal for .NET Programmers
7 Modules That Will Turn Your Drupal Site into A...
LSD Good for Enterprise Organizations
Best practices for coding in Drupal
NJ and Drupal - Perfect Together
Last Chance for the First EVER DrupalCamp NJ!
7 Myths About Open Source and How Drupal Debunks...
How to increase conversion rates in Drupal

Categories

Drupal
Best Practices
Drupal How to
Drupal Planet
Drupal Training
Graphic and Flash Design
Internet Marketing Tips
Learning Series
Technology Tools
Usability
Your Drupal Surprise

@BlinkReaction

  • Get your Instagram pics up on #drupalf2f before the crowd! See them on http://t.co/YKxZW49OPE @drupalcon
    May 20, 2013
  • Wheels up blinkreaction house drupalcon #drupalf2f http://t.co/LDovasWgF5
    May 20, 2013
Read more

Ideas

A New Milestone for Blink Reaction
May 17, 2013

When I founded Blink, I did so on the foundation of my core business principles - principles that I’ve honored my entire...

Launching Drupal Face to Face
May 17, 2013

We're pleased to announce Drupal Face to Face, our joint initiative with the Drupal Association to...

Read more

News

Drupal Dev Days - Drupal Camping
May 17, 2013
Daystage Drupalcon, Portland
May 17, 2013
PHARMA'S DRUPAL Rx - Treating Multiple Pain Points
May 17, 2013
Read more
© 2005-2013 Blink Reaction. All rights reserved.
  • Home
  • Clients
  • About
  • Ideas
  • Institute
  • Careers
  • Contact